草庐IT

ota升级

全部标签

【JUC】二十八、synchronized锁升级之偏向锁

文章目录1、偏向锁出现的背景2、从共享对象的内存结构看偏向锁3、偏向锁的持有4、启动偏向锁5、sleep暂停来启动偏向锁6、偏向锁的撤销7、总体流程8、SinceJava15偏向锁的废除1、偏向锁出现的背景如果一个线程连续几次抢到锁,仍然重复加锁解锁,就会导致用户态和内核态频繁切换,这显然是有改进空间的。如之前买票的例子:publicclassSaleTick{publicstaticvoidmain(String[]args){Ticketticket=newTicket();newThread(()->{for(inti=0;i50;i++){ticket.sale();}},"t1").

汉缆股份携手航天科技AIRIOT建设智慧工厂,加速数字化转型升级

工业4.0时代,工厂早已不是传统概念里流水线与机器制造的简单叠加,而是伴随工业互联网技术的发展,持续朝数字化与智能化方向演进,打造智慧工厂已成为众多制造企业转型升级的共同选择。近期,航天科技控股集团股份有限公司(以下简称”航天科技“)旗下AIRIOT与青岛汉缆股份有限公司(以下简称”青岛汉缆“)达成合作,围绕智能生产、智能供应链、智能管理等方面共同打造智慧工厂,助推汉缆股份降本增效,缔造核心竞争力,实现高质量发展。合作伙伴介绍青岛汉缆股份有限公司成立于1982年,现已发展成为行业领先的能为客户提供电缆及附件、电力设计、输变电工程、竣工试验、运行维护及服务、氢能源应用系统等全套解决方案和交钥匙工

CentOS7 OpenSSL升级到OpenSSH9.5p1

原文链接:CentOS7OpenSSL升级1.1.1w;OpenSSH升级9.5p1保姆级教程openssl从3.1.0升级到3.1.1遇到的问题注意操作时需要联网请参考如下链接内网服务器联网安装依赖参见我的另一篇文章一、前言OpenSSH的加密功能需要用到OpenSSL,所以在升级OpenSSH的时候,大部分情况是需要将OpenSSL一起升级的。这里我们可以先升级OpenSSL到OpenSSL1.1.1w11Sep2023然后再升级OpenSSH到OpenSSH_9.5p1,OpenSSL1.1.1w11Sep2023当然也可以从第三步开始操作,如果你的OpenSSL版本太低会遇到报错con

java - 我如何/我可以从 Eclipse 升级 Java?

我是JAva/Eclipse/Android的新手,但正在准备中!我已经安装并运行了所有东西,但想知道Java是如何升级的。可以通过Eclipse完成吗?我注意到JDK安装每次都希望根据其版本创建一个新文件夹。我会做任何需要做的事情,但感谢您的意见让我开始。 最佳答案 只需按照通常的方式安装JDK。新文件夹没有问题。安装JDK后,您可以通过Window>Preferences>Java>InstalledJREs指示Eclipse使用它。您可以在那里添加或编辑已安装的JRE。如果您选择编辑,您只需更改主目录和名称。

android - 升级到 android sdk tools 20/platform sdk tools 12 后无法再启动应用程序

我升级了我的sdk工具,现在我不能再从Eclipse启动应用程序(我仍然可以从命令行安装。当我启动时,我看到一个错误窗口和一个空的设备选择器。错误窗口显示:Anerrorhasoccurred.Seeerrorlogformoredetails.com.android.ddmlib.IDevice.getName()Ljava/lang/String;我不确定要查找什么日志。DDMS也认为设备正常。我不确定这里出了什么问题,在谷歌或SO上找不到任何东西。谢谢 最佳答案 卸载然后重新安装工具解决了问题。

道可云会展元宇宙平台全新升级,打造3D沉浸式展会新模式

随着VR虚拟现实、人工智能、虚拟数字人等元宇宙技术的快速发展,各个行业正试图通过元宇宙技术寻求新的发展突破口,会展行业也不例外。会展作为经贸领域的重要产业形态,越来越多的企业和组织开始寻求通过元宇宙技术为展会赋能,以满足日益增长的数字化需求。国务院印发的《“十四五”数字经济发展规划》中明确提出,打造智慧共享的新型数字生活。创新发展“云生活”服务,深化人工智能、虚拟现实、8K高清视频等技术的融合,拓展展览、社交、购物、娱乐等领域的应用,促进生活消费品质升级。为赋能会展行业数字化转型和创新发展,打造沉浸式展会新模式。作为中国领先的创新元宇宙厂商,道可云基于自身在元宇宙、VR、AR、虚拟数字人等领域

k8s基础4——deployment控制器、应用部署、升级、回滚、水平扩容缩容

文章目录一、基本介绍二、应用程序生命周期2.1部署应用2.2应用升级2.2.1修改YAML文件升级(交互式)2.2.2命令指定镜像版本升级(免交互式)2.2.3调用vim升级2.3滚动升级2.3.1升级流程2.4应用回滚2.4.1查看历史发布版本2.4.2回滚到上一个版本2.4.3回滚到指定版本2.4.4验证升级时会访问到新、老两个版本2.5水平扩缩容一、基本介绍基本了解:Deployment是最常用的K8s工作负载控制器(WorkloadControllers),实际项目部署调试中必用资源之一,所以必须要熟练掌握deploy资源的使用。它是K8s的一个抽象概念,用于更高级层次对象,部署和管理

Ubuntu/Linux 升级 CMake 版本

Ubuntu/Linux升级CMake版本背景在Ubuntu18.04系统上默认的CMake版本为3.10.2,当需要进行一些比较新的项目的编译时,比如说iceoryx的交叉编译,会遇到CMake版本不支持问题。类似下面的打印:CMakeErroratCMakeLists.txt:17(cmake_minimum_required):CMake3.16orhigherisrequired.Youarerunningversion3.10.2这时我们需要升级系统中的CMake,从3.10.2升级到3.16+版本。解决方案在CMake网站的Download页面AlternativeBinaryRe

【DataSophon】大数据服务组件之Flink升级

🦄 个人主页——🎐开着拖拉机回家_Linux,大数据运维-CSDN博客 🎐✨🍁🪁🍁🪁🍁🪁🍁🪁🍁🪁🍁🪁🍁🪁🍁🪁🪁🍁🪁🍁🪁🍁🪁🍁🪁🍁🪁🍁感谢点赞和关注,每天进步一点点!加油!目录一、DataSophon是什么1.1DataSophon概述1.2架构概览1.3设计思想二、解压新旧组件安装包三、修改安装包中文件和目录四、重新生成安装包3.1重新打包3.2生成加密码3.3生成md5加密文件五、删除已装的组件包flink(ALL)六、修改service_ddl.json七、修改env环境变量(ALL)7.1修改环境变量配置参数(ALL)7.2重启manager服务八、重新安装服务九、测试验证一、DataS

android - 升级后 App 中的 VerifyError

我有一个小问题,希望有人能给我一些见解。有时,当用户从市场更新我的应用程序(从一个版本到另一个版本)时,他们在运行应用程序时会收到VerifyError。它发生在一个随机类(class);您可以使用应用程序的一部分,然后转到应用程序中的其他Activity会导致它崩溃。这只会发生一次;一旦Dalvik将它从系统中取出,它就再也不会发生了。因为它每次更新只发生一次(而且大多数时候根本不会发生),这无疑是一个小问题,但我认为它对我的应用程序反射(reflect)不好,所以如果有人有任何想法会很棒。堆栈跟踪似乎没什么用,因为它们总是发生在不同的地方(这让我更加困惑)。这是一个示例:java.